Ok I have an old Saab 9-3 aero driving about 25k a year it costs me £500ish a month in fuel alone.
My commute is 140 miles round trip.
I live in a flat so charging an EV at home currently it’s not possible however I can charge at work plus I have fleet services.

I like the sound of the Tesla 3 plus speaking with them at Westfield shopping centre they said I would be looking at around £550 a month on PCP 3 year deal.
Can charge at work for free plus fleet as Tesla fast charge.
I have seen golf do an electric as well.
So
My question is any other recommendations suggestions?
Would like 300ish mile range. Mostly use it for commute 25k a year.
£600 a month max.
Comfortable plus I do have a 2 year old as well.
Open to second hand market I have read about older Tesla models have some free charging or something.
